The security of WiFi networks in hotels can vary. Many hotels implement measures to protect their networks, such as encryption. However, businesses frequently emphasize that guests should avoid accessing sensitive information, like online banking, while using public WiFi. For added security, consider using a Virtual Private Network (VPN) when connecting to hotel WiFi to help safeguard your data and privacy.

WiFi strength can vary based on location within the hotel. Typically, the reception area, lobby, and dining areas may offer stronger signals due to proximity to WiFi routers. In contrast, rooms furthest from these access points may experience weaker connections. It's a good idea to ask the hotel staff about the optimal locations for a reliable WiFi connection, and they may even provide specific advice or offer to change your room if needed.
If you encounter WiFi issues in your hotel room, there are several troubleshooting steps you can take. First, check to ensure that you have the correct login information, as hotels often provide specific credentials for accessing their networks. If you're experiencing poor connectivity, try moving closer to the door or window, as walls can obstruct signals. Restarting your device is also a simple yet effective solution. If problems persist, contact the front desk for assistance—they might be able to help you or provide an alternative solution.
Data usage limits for WiFi in hotels can depend on individual hotel policies. While many hotels provide unlimited WiFi access, some may impose certain restrictions, such as limiting bandwidth during peak hours to maintain service quality for all guests. It’s advisable to inquire about any potential data limits or speed restrictions upon check-in, particularly if you plan to use the internet extensively during your stay.
